First things first. I do NOT like the Wizards and I have never been a fan of Michael Jordan (hate to see him go though) but I will play the role of a GM.
1) Let Stackhouse walk.
-not worth the money that he`ll be looking for
-Jordan doesn`t seem to like him anyway (couldn`t get along on the court and I guess Jordan feels Stack doesn`t play with enough heart)
2) Fire Doug Collins
-hey, he did it once. The game has passed Collins. It has changed and he hasn`t.
3) Hire Del Harris
-Best coaching candidate out there IMO is Van Gundy but Jordan and Van Gundy have never seen eye-to-eye.
4) Start Kwame Brown at PF.
-You drafted this kid at #1. Give him some minutes. He put up some numbers during summer camps (who doesn`t) but he has the size to be somewhat effective in the East. He seemed scared to play ALONGSIDE Jordan so maybe having a couple years under his belt and Jordan far from the court will help him mentally.
5) Give Juan Dixon and Jared Jeffries more minutes.
-they`re young, athletic and full of energy. damn a veteran (although I always like Oakley).
6) Use their Lottery pick on a PG (a real PG).
-I like Larry Hughes, but he`s a 2 guard. Tyronn Lue will be a career backup. And, despite his size, Juan Dixon is a natural 2 guard. Don`t play him at point anymore.
7) Sign Lamar Odom
-not sure if he`s a restricted free agent, but his overall play will compensate a bit for losing Jordan and Stackhouse. He`ll get the younger players involved (won`t help them win much but will get them touches).
I think because of their youth, they`ll struggle again next year. But the year after that, they should be a playoff contender.

First of all I would trade Stackhouse for a C or PF. Oakley and MJ will be gone (unless MJ "suprises" us all which is highly unlikely). Laettner's contract will be up and even though he has been playing well, I would probably choose not to re-sign him unless of course he accepts a major pay cut :-) . I would probably try and trade Bryon Russell for a good perimeter player who can hit the three.
Tyronn Lue..... This guy is still learning and will get better. I would have him as my reserve PG.
Bobby Simmons.... I would keep this guy as he has been playing pretty well as of late. My reserve SG.
Etan Thomas.... definitely keep this guy. He has the best post game on the Wiz and plays with energy. My reserve PF.
Jahidi White..... Keep this guy too. He adds rebounding and toughness. My reserve C who I would probably start half the time anyway over B.Haywood.
My starting five would be (not taking into consideration the stackhouse trade that I mentioned):
C - Brendan Haywood
PF - Kwame Brown
SF - Jared Jeffries
SG - Larry Hughes
PG - Juan Dixon
Sure, they may suck for a couple of years, but hopefully Kwame will be the main man in the next couple of years.Comment
